ARLINGTON, Va. — NTCA–The Rural Broadband Association recently recognized Ron Ellis of Nex-Tech as a winner of the NTCA Key Employee Excellence Award for going above and beyond during his 30 years at Nex-Tech, achieving ambitious fiber construction goals for the company.

Nex-Tech is a member of NTCA, the premier association representing nearly 850 independent, community-based telecommunications companies in rural communities across America. The NTCA Excellence Awards recognize those NTCA members who have shown exceptional commitment to their communities and the rural broadband industry. Winners are selected by the association’s Awards Committee, comprised of NTCA members.

“It is truly an honor to present these awards every year, and recognizing those individuals whose accomplishments have made such an impact on the rural broadband industry is one of my very favorite parts of my job,” said NTCA Chief Executive Officer Shirley Bloomfield, who presented the awards. “I want to congratulate Ron Ellis and thank each and every one of our award winners for their contributions to our industry.”

“Ron Ellis is someone that I truly enjoyed working with because he was always ready to do what it takes to get things done, whether that meant rolling up your sleeves and getting busy or thinking of a new way or approach to get a task done better or safer,” said Jimmy Todd, Nex-Tech CEO/General Manager. “Ron’s work ethic and attitude set the example for many to follow, and we are a better organization because of his influence.”

“I’ve had the best of times working at Nex-Tech,” said Ron Ellis. “I’m honored to be part of a progressive company, and I know that doesn’t happen without the support of a progressive board and executive management team leading the way. Thank you!”

After 30 years at Nex-Tech and in the telecommunications industry, Ron recently retired on July 31. More here.
